Appraising Your House The Right Way

If you are one of those individuals that want to move to a more spacious house because you want to settle down and begin a family of your own, then you may be inclined to sell your existing house. But among the hurdles that you have to overcome are those of setting the right price.

Even if you are investing in real estate and you want to resell the house, deciding on the right price is no less challenging.

You should know that there should be a difference the figure that you bought the house at and that which you are going to sell it at. All factors considered, it could be lower, but not necessarily. You can remodel and give the house a brand new look, both inside and out to increase its value, but even with that you will be in a quandary on how much to sell it. The good thing is that there are professionals who can help you get the exact price.

It would be wise to acknowledge the fact that all the possible buyers will bargain hard. It’s only natural especially since they will want a lower price than proposed rate. To make this a winning case for you as the seller, you have to adjust the asking rate by a little percentage. You need to ensure that the price is neither too high so as to discourage all potential buyers from asking about the home, nor too low as to underscore your expected selling price after the bargaining process is complete.
